Merge remote-tracking branch 'origin/dev' into dev

pull/4/head^2
dearlin 2024-02-26 11:37:58 +08:00
commit 918037d593
3 changed files with 44 additions and 15 deletions

View File

@ -1974,6 +1974,7 @@ public class HiddenController extends BaseController {
pd.put("RECTIFICATIONTYPE","2");
if (list.size() == 0) {
inspection.put("INSPECTION_STATUS", "5"); // 指派完成
pd.put("STATE", "1"); //未整改
} else {
inspection.put("INSPECTION_STATUS", "4"); // 指派中
}

View File

@ -5,6 +5,7 @@ import com.alibaba.fastjson.JSONObject;
import com.zcloud.entity.Page;
import com.zcloud.entity.PageData;
import com.zcloud.mapper.datasource.inspection.SafetyEnvironmentalMapper;
import com.zcloud.mapper.datasource.system.UsersMapper;
import com.zcloud.service.bus.*;
import com.zcloud.service.hidden.HiddenService;
import com.zcloud.service.inspection.*;
@ -59,6 +60,8 @@ public class SafetyEnvironmentalServiceImpl implements SafetyEnvironmentalServic
private DepartmentService departmentService;
@Autowired
private SafetyEnvironmentalExplainService explainService;
@Resource
private UsersMapper usersMapper;
@Resource
private NoticeCorpUtil noticeCorpUtil;
@ -150,18 +153,23 @@ public class SafetyEnvironmentalServiceImpl implements SafetyEnvironmentalServic
hidden.put("HIDDENDESCR", json.getString("HIDDENDESCR")); //隐患描述
hidden.put("HIDDENPART", json.getString("HIDDENPART")); //隐患部位
hidden.put("HIDDENLEVEL", json.getString("HIDDENLEVEL")); //隐患级别
hidden.put("HIDDENTYPE_NAME", json.getString("HIDDENTYPENAME"));//隐患类型名称
hidden.put("HIDDENTYPE_NAME", json.getString("HIDDENTYPE_NAME"));//隐患类型名称
hidden.put("LONGITUDE", json.getString("LONGITUDE")); //隐患位置经度
hidden.put("LATITUDE", json.getString("LATITUDE")); //隐患位置纬度
hidden.put("DISCOVERYTIME", json.getString("DISCOVERYTIME")); //隐患发现时间
hidden.put("HIDDENFINDDEPT", json.getString("HIDDENFINDDEPT")); //隐患发现部门(隐患责任人部门)
hidden.put("CREATOR", json.getString("CREATOR")); //发现人(隐患责任人)
PageData user = new PageData();
user.put("USER_ID",json.getString("CREATOR"));
user = usersMapper.findById(user);
if (user != null) {
hidden.put("HIDDENFINDDEPT", user.getString("DEPARTMENT_ID")); //隐患发现部门(隐患责任人部门)
}
hidden.put("SOURCE", json.getString("SOURCE")); //发现人(隐患责任人)
hidden.put("ISRELEVANT",json.getString("ISRELEVANT"));//是否相关方1是2否
hidden.put("STATE", "100"); //隐患状态 100-安全环保检查暂存的隐患流程完转0
hidden.put("CREATTIME", time); //发现时间
hidden.put("CORPINFO_ID", pd.getString("CORPINFO_ID"));
hidden.put("RECTIFICATIONTYPE", pd.getString("RECTIFICATIONTYPE"));
hidden.put("RECTIFICATIONTYPE", "2");
hidden.put("ISDELETE", "0"); //是否删除(0:有效 1删除)
hidden.put("POSITIONDESC",json.getString("POSITIONDESC"));
hiddenService.save(hidden);

View File

@ -2546,22 +2546,42 @@
update
<include refid="tableName"></include>
set
STATE = #{STATE},
CONFIRM_USER = #{CONFIRM_USER},
CONFIRM_TIME = #{CONFIRM_TIME},
RECTIFICATIONTYPE = #{RECTIFICATIONTYPE},
RECTIFICATIONDEADLINE = #{RECTIFICATIONDEADLINE},
ISCONFIRM = #{ISCONFIRM},
RECTIFICATIONDEPT = #{RECTIFICATIONDEPT},
RECTIFICATIONOR = #{RECTIFICATIONOR},
CHECKDEPT = #{CHECKDEPT},
CHECKOR = #{CHECKOR},
HIDDEN_ID = HIDDEN_ID
<if test="STATE != null and STATE != ''">
STATE = #{STATE},
</if>
<if test="CONFIRM_USER != null and CONFIRM_USER != ''">
CONFIRM_USER = #{CONFIRM_USER},
</if>
<if test="CONFIRM_TIME != null and CONFIRM_TIME != ''">
CONFIRM_TIME = #{CONFIRM_TIME},
</if>
<if test="RECTIFICATIONTYPE != null and RECTIFICATIONTYPE != ''">
RECTIFICATIONTYPE = #{RECTIFICATIONTYPE},
</if>
<if test="RECTIFICATIONDEADLINE != null and RECTIFICATIONDEADLINE != ''">
RECTIFICATIONDEADLINE = #{RECTIFICATIONDEADLINE},
</if>
<if test="ISCONFIRM != null and ISCONFIRM != ''">
ISCONFIRM = #{ISCONFIRM},
</if>
<if test="RECTIFICATIONDEPT != null and RECTIFICATIONDEPT != ''">
RECTIFICATIONDEPT = #{RECTIFICATIONDEPT},
</if>
<if test="RECTIFICATIONOR != null and RECTIFICATIONOR != ''">
RECTIFICATIONOR = #{RECTIFICATIONOR},
</if>
<if test="CHECKDEPT != null and CHECKDEPT != ''">
CHECKDEPT = #{CHECKDEPT},
</if>
<if test="CHECKOR != null and CHECKOR != ''">
CHECKOR = #{CHECKOR},
</if>
HIDDEN_ID = HIDDEN_ID
<if test="RECTIFICATIONTYPE != null and RECTIFICATIONTYPE != ''">
,RECTIFICATIONTYPE = #{RECTIFICATIONTYPE}
</if>
where
HIDDEN_ID = #{HIDDEN_ID}
HIDDEN_ID = #{HIDDEN_ID}
</update>
<!-- 验收 -->